The physical benefits of deep breathing are extensive. By inhaling deeply and exhaling fully, the lungs expand completely, increasing oxygen intake and improving circulation. This process supports heart health, strengthens the respiratory system, and helps remove toxins from the body. Deep breathing also promotes relaxation by stimulating the parasympathetic nervous system, which reduces heart rate and blood pressure, creating a state of calm.

Incorporating deep breathing into a daily routine is simple and requires no special equipment. One common method involves inhaling slowly through the nose, holding the breath for a few seconds, and then exhaling gently through the mouth. Repeating this cycle several times can quickly alleviate tension and bring a sense of relaxation. In addition to stress relief and energy, deep breathing supports better sleep. By practicing calming breaths before bedtime, the nervous system is guided into a relaxed state, promoting deeper and more restorative sleep. Improved sleep quality has a cascading effect on mood, cognitive function, and overall health.
